In an athletic composition, the probability that an athlete wins a 100m race is (frac{1}{8}) and the probability that he wins in high jump is (frac{1}{4}). What is the probability that he wins only one of the events?
  • A.
    (frac{3}{32})
  • B.
    (frac{7}{3})
  • C.
    (frac{5}{3})
  • D.
    (frac{5}{16})
Correct Answer: Option D
Explanation

Pr. (winning 100m race) = (frac{1}{8})
Pr. (losing 100m race) = 1 – (frac{1}{8}) = (frac{7}{8})
Pr. (winning high jump) = (frac{1}{4})
Pr. (losing high jump ) = 1 – (frac{1}{4}) = (frac{3}{4})
Pr. (winning only one) = Pr. (Winning 100m race and losing high jump) or Pr.(Losing 100m race and winning high jump)
= ((frac{1}{8} times frac{3}{4})) + ((frac{7}{8} times frac{1}{4}))
= (frac{3}{32} + frac{7}{32})
= (frac{10}{32})
= (frac{5}{16})
